Subject: [bluetooth-next 14/16] Bluetooth: move L2CAP sock timers function to l2cap_sock.c
Date: Fri, 4 Feb 2011 04:01:56 -0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1296799318-5517-15-git-send-email-padovan@profusion.mobi>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1296799318-5517-14-git-send-email-padovan@profusion.mobi>
Signed-off-by: Gustavo F. Padovan <padovan@profusion.mobi>
---
net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c | 13 -------------
net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c | 13 +++++++++++++
2 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
index 4e3a06e..1baa16c 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
@@ -77,19 +77,6 @@ static struct sk_buff *l2cap_build_cmd(struct l2cap_conn *conn,
static int l2cap_ertm_data_rcv(struct sock *sk, struct sk_buff *skb);
-/* ---- L2CAP timers ---- */
-void l2cap_sock_set_timer(struct sock *sk, long timeout)
-{
- BT_DBG("sk %p state %d timeout %ld", sk, sk->sk_state, timeout);
- sk_reset_timer(sk, &sk->sk_timer, jiffies + timeout);
-}
-
-void l2cap_sock_clear_timer(struct sock *sk)
-{
- BT_DBG("sock %p state %d", sk, sk->sk_state);
- sk_stop_timer(sk, &sk->sk_timer);
-}
-
/* ---- L2CAP channels ---- */
static struct sock *__l2cap_get_chan_by_dcid(struct l2cap_chan_list *l, u16 cid)
{
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
index fe4f834..23bb968 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
@@ -30,6 +30,7 @@
#include <net/bluetooth/hci_core.h>
#include <net/bluetooth/l2cap.h>
+/* ---- L2CAP timers ---- */
static void l2cap_sock_timeout(unsigned long arg)
{
struct sock *sk = (struct sock *) arg;
@@ -63,6 +64,18 @@ static void l2cap_sock_timeout(unsigned long arg)
sock_put(sk);
}
+void l2cap_sock_set_timer(struct sock *sk, long timeout)
+{
+ BT_DBG("sk %p state %d timeout %ld", sk, sk->sk_state, timeout);
+ sk_reset_timer(sk, &sk->sk_timer, jiffies + timeout);
+}
+
+void l2cap_sock_clear_timer(struct sock *sk)
+{
+ BT_DBG("sock %p state %d", sk, sk->sk_state);
+ sk_stop_timer(sk, &sk->sk_timer);
+}
+
static struct sock *__l2cap_get_sock_by_addr(__le16 psm, bdaddr_t *src)
{
struct sock *sk;
